A Brief History of Salt & Straw

The Founding Vision

Salt & Straw was founded in 2011 by cousins Kim Malek and Tyler Malek in Portland, Oregon. Kim, who had worked at Starbucks during its early growth phase, yearned for the sense of community and connection to producers that she experienced when the company was small. Tyler, on the other hand, had a passion for food and flavor, which was ignited during his travels in Asia.

The two cousins shared a vision of creating an ice – cream brand that was more than just a place to buy a sweet treat. They wanted to build a community – centered business that celebrated local ingredients, unique flavors, and the art of ice – cream making. Their initial concept was to create an ice – cream base that was simple, made with high – quality ingredients, and could be flavored in countless ways.

The Birth of the Food Cart

Salt & Straw’s journey started with a food cart on Portland’s Alberta Street. It was a tough yet thrilling start. Tyler, without formal ice – cream – making training, was set on making his wild flavor ideas a reality. He learned flavor – creation from experts like chocolatiers, brewers, and cheese – makers to apply to ice cream.

The food cart let them test ideas and build a local customer base. They offered unique flavors from the get – go. One of their first and most popular was Sea Salt with Caramel Ribbons, co – created with Mark Bitterman from The Meadow. Using high – quality Guatemalan fleur de sel in the ice – cream base, along with hand – burned caramel, made it an instant favorite with customers.

Expansion to Brick – and – Mortar Stores

Just three months after the food cart launch, Salt & Straw opened its first brick – and – mortar store. This was a major growth milestone. The physical store offered a more comfortable space for customers to savor ice – cream and allowed for an expanded menu and better brand showcase.

Following the first store’s success, Salt & Straw kept expanding in Portland, with each location tailored to the local community. As the brand grew in popularity, it ventured beyond Portland. In 2014, it opened its first out – of – Oregon store in Los Angeles, highlighting the rising appeal of its unique ice – cream flavors.

The Signature Ice – Cream Flavors

Unconventional and Creative Combinations

Salt & Straw stands out for daring to experiment with extraordinary flavor pairings. Tyler Malek, the creative force behind the flavors, has a talent for drawing inspiration from unlikely places.

Take the Arbequina Olive Oil and Almond Brittle flavor. It combines the rich, fruity Arbequina olive oil with sweet, crunchy almond brittle, achieving a unique balance of savory and sweet. The Bone Marrow with Smoked Cherries is another odd – yet – amazing flavor. The creamy bone marrow and smoky, tart smoked cherries blend to create a luxurious and unexpected taste.

Use of Local and Seasonal Ingredients

Salt & Straw is committed to using local and seasonal ingredients in their ice – cream. This not only ensures the freshness of their products but also supports local farmers and producers. In the summer months, when berries are in season, you can expect to find flavors like Strawberry Honey Balsamic with Black Pepper. The sweet, juicy strawberries are combined with a honey – balsamic reduction and a hint of black pepper, creating a flavor that captures the essence of summer.

During the fall, flavors like Pumpkin and Bourbon Caramel make an appearance. The pumpkins are sourced locally, and the bourbon caramel adds a warm, indulgent touch. This use of seasonal ingredients means that there’s always something new and exciting to try at Salt & Straw, depending on the time of year.

Customer Favorites

Over time, some flavors have become customer favorites and mainstays on Salt & Straw’s menu. Sea Salt with Caramel Ribbons, a top – seller, combines simple yet indulgent salt and caramel, appealing to many. Chocolate Gooey Brownie, with rich chocolate ice – cream and fudgy, gluten – free brownie chunks, is a hit with chocolate lovers.

Honey Lavender, balancing lavender’s floral scent with local honey’s sweetness, is also popular. These beloved flavors not only retain regulars but also draw in new customers eager to taste what makes Salt & Straw so well – liked.

The Salt & Straw Experience

Store Ambiance

When you walk into a Salt & Straw store, you’re greeted with a warm and inviting atmosphere. The stores are designed to be a place where customers can relax and enjoy their ice – cream. The decor often features a modern, yet rustic aesthetic, with elements that play off the salt – and – straw theme.

There are comfortable seating areas, allowing customers to sit and savor their ice – cream. The open – kitchen concept, where you can see the ice – cream being made, adds to the experience. The staff is friendly and knowledgeable, always ready to offer samples and answer any questions about the flavors.

Community Engagement

Salt & Straw is highly dedicated to local community engagement. They partner with local PTAs and organizations addressing human rights and hunger. For instance, they donate part of the earnings from specific flavors or events to local charities.

The brand also collaborates with local artisans, farmers, and suppliers. In Miami, they used local guava and key lime in flavors, honoring the city’s food culture. This community work builds a positive brand image and fosters loyalty among local customers.

The Scooping Experience

The way the ice – cream is scooped at Salt & Straw is also part of the experience. The staff is trained to scoop the ice – cream in a way that showcases the flavors and textures. Whether it’s layering different flavors or carefully placing the toppings, the scooping process is done with care and precision.

Customers can also choose from a variety of toppings, which are often made in – house. From homemade whipped cream to artisanal chocolate sauce, the toppings add an extra touch of indulgence to the ice – cream. The attention to detail in the scooping and topping process ensures that each customer gets a visually appealing and delicious ice – cream treat.

The Business Model and Growth

Quality – Over – Quantity Approach

Salt & Straw’s business model is centered around a quality – over – quantity approach. They focus on using high – quality ingredients, even if it means paying a premium. The milk and cream used in their ice – cream are sourced from local dairies that prioritize the well – being of their cows. The fruits and other ingredients are also carefully selected for their flavor and freshness.

This commitment to quality is reflected in the price of their ice – cream, which is relatively higher compared to some mass – market ice – cream brands. However, customers are willing to pay for the superior taste and the unique experience that Salt & Straw offers. By maintaining this focus on quality, the brand has been able to build a reputation for excellence in the ice – cream market.

Expansion and Franchising

As Salt & Straw has grown in popularity, they have expanded their footprint across the United States. They have opened stores in major cities like San Francisco, New York City, and Seattle. In addition to company – owned stores, they have also explored franchising opportunities.

Franchising allows them to reach new markets while maintaining the brand’s standards. Franchisees are required to follow strict guidelines for store design, ingredient sourcing, and ice – cream making. This ensures that whether you visit a Salt & Straw store in Portland or in a new franchise location in a different city, you can expect the same high – quality ice – cream and customer experience.

Marketing and Branding

Salt & Straw has a strong marketing and branding strategy that focuses on telling the story behind the brand. Their marketing materials often highlight the unique flavor combinations, the use of local ingredients, and the community – centered values of the brand.

They are active on social media, where they share mouth – watering photos of their ice – cream flavors, behind – the – scenes videos of the ice – cream making process, and updates on new store openings and special events. They also collaborate with food bloggers, influencers, and media outlets to get the word out about their brand. This effective marketing and branding have helped Salt & Straw build a strong brand identity and a loyal customer base.

Challenges and How They’ve Been Overcome

Competition in the Ice – Cream Market

The ice – cream market is highly competitive, with numerous chains and local shops vying for customers’ attention. Salt & Straw faces competition from both large, well – established ice – cream brands with significant marketing budgets and small, local artisanal ice – cream shops.

To stand out, Salt & Straw focuses on its unique selling points. Their creative flavor combinations, use of high – quality local ingredients, and community engagement set them apart. They also constantly innovate, introducing new flavors and products to keep customers interested. For example, they have started to offer vegan and dairy – free ice – cream options to cater to a wider range of dietary preferences.

Maintaining Quality and Consistency

With expansion comes the challenge of maintaining quality and consistency across all locations. Ensuring that the ice – cream tastes the same and is of the same high – quality whether you’re in Portland or Los Angeles is no easy feat.

Salt & Straw addresses this by working closely with their suppliers to ensure a consistent supply of high – quality ingredients. They also invest heavily in training their staff. All employees, from store managers to scoopers, undergo comprehensive training on ice – cream making, flavor pairings, and customer service. This training helps to ensure that the same standards are maintained in every store, regardless of its location.

Adapting to Changing Consumer Trends

Food industry consumer trends are always changing. Lately, there’s a rising demand for healthier ice – cream and a preference for sustainably and ethically sourced ingredients.

Salt & Straw has adjusted. They’ve added more vegan and dairy – free flavors made with coconut or almond milk. They also use sustainable packaging and source from local, ethical farmers. By following these trends, Salt & Straw keeps its customers interested and attracts new ones seeking health – conscious and sustainable ice – cream.
